MONELL v. GOLFVIEW ROAD ASS'N

No. 76-1918.

359 So.2d 2 (1978)

Edmund C. MONELL, Appellant, v. GOLFVIEW ROAD ASSOCIATION, Appellee.

District Court of Appeal of Florida, Fourth District.

Rehearing Denied June 19, 1978.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Thomas V. Close of Falcon & Villwock, Palm Beach, for appellant.

James F. Cooney, Jr., of Coe & Broberg, Palm Beach, for appellee.


BERANEK, JOHN R., Associate Judge.

This is an appeal from a final judgment denying appellant's request for a mandatory injunction. The appellee is the "GOLFVIEW ROAD ASSOCIATION" which is composed of most of the homeowners living on a private road in the Town of Palm Beach. Appellant is an individual homeowner living on this same private road, but who chose not to become a member of the Association.
